Memory seat q
 
Hey guys, search was done but no good direction. For some reason, every time I get in my X I have top press #1 on the seat to go back to where I want it. Is there any way to leave this setting as default so I dont have to press it everytime I drive?! Very perplexing!

diyanich 06-04-2010 09:00 PM

hi,put your key in the position 2,but don't crank put your seat the way you like it to be and press M and desired # ...it should stay there the next time you unlock.
good luck

mywidebody02 12-16-2010 09:56 PM

U need the GT1 to check this but this is what it is. default for this is not active.

Seat Settings
(Mirror memory is available on E46
vehicles since 09/99 production)
when unlocking
when opening a door
not active

The automatic seat adjustment is activated by the specific key being used if the vehicle is
equipped with seat memory. Setting in Car Memory defines when the actual adjustment
starts: when pressing unlock button on remote, or when opening the door.
3,5,7,x5
